    Description

      Graphical Effects look very different in Qt 6 compared to Qt 5: https://www.qt.io/blog/a-short-guide-to-qt-quick-effects However, information on how to port is scattered.

       

      Suggestions

      1. For every 6.0/6.1/6.2 specific page under https://doc.qt.io/qt-6/portingguide.html#check-the-changes-to-the-modules the up-to-date  version of that page should be merged into https://doc.qt.io/qt-6/modulechanges.html
      2. The merged section about "Qt Graphical Effects" should point to all available Effects technologies (and ideally an overview on how to choose between them - see the blog post above)
      3. https://doc.qt.io/qt-6/portingguide.html#check-the-changes-to-the-modules should point to the up-to-date https://doc.qt.io/qt-6/modulechanges.html, and the 6.0/6.1/6.2 specific links should disappear
      4. https://doc.qt.io/qt-6/qtgraphicaleffects5-index.html should point to the new, consolidated information above

       

      (These suggestions are focused on Qt Graphical Effects, but all other modules would benefit too)
